The Evolution and Benefits of Finned Brake Drums


In the world of automotive engineering, efficiency and safety are paramount. One of the critical components that contribute to the safe operation of vehicles is the braking system. Over the years, engineers have continuously sought ways to improve braking performance, leading to innovations such as the finned brake drum. These specialized brake drums offer several advantages over traditional designs, mainly due to their unique structure and material properties.


Finned brake drums are characterized by their finned design, which creates additional surface area. This design is primarily aimed at enhancing heat dissipation during braking. When a vehicle slows down, kinetic energy is converted into thermal energy due to friction between the brake shoes and the drum. Traditional brake drums can accumulate excessive heat, which can lead to brake fade—an alarming condition where the brakes become less effective due to overheating. Finned brake drums address this issue by allowing for more efficient cooling. The fins facilitate airflow around the drum, helping to disperse heat more effectively and maintaining optimal braking performance.


One of the significant advantages of finned brake drums is their ability to improve vehicle safety. Vehicles equipped with these specialized drums can experience reduced brake fade, resulting in more consistent stopping power. This enhanced performance is especially crucial for heavy-duty vehicles or those that frequently operate under high-demand conditions, such as towing or hilly terrain driving. The enhanced cooling also extends the lifespan of the brake components, reducing maintenance costs and improving overall vehicle reliability.

Furthermore, the finned design contributes to the weight distribution of the braking system. Traditional brake drums can be heavy, which can affect a vehicle's overall weight and handling characteristics. By utilizing advanced materials such as aluminum or other lightweight composites in conjunction with the finned design, manufacturers can produce brake drums that reduce the vehicle's unsprung weight. This reduction leads to improved handling, better fuel efficiency, and overall enhanced driving dynamics.


Another interesting aspect of finned brake drums is their versatility. While often used in heavy-duty applications, they can also be beneficial for performance-oriented vehicles. High-performance cars that require rapid braking capabilities can also use finned brake drums, ensuring that they maintain peak performance even during aggressive driving or high-speed situations.
